Florian Josef Janik (born 6 March 1980) is a German politician and mayor of Erlangen since 1 May 2014.


Biography

In July 1999 Janik completed Abitur at the Ohm-Gymnasium in Erlangen. In 1999 and 2000 he attended Alternative civilian service, civilian service at the ''Arbeiter-Samariter-Bund'' Erlangen-Höchstadt. He studied social science at the University of Erlangen-Nuremberg from 2001 to 2005. Since 2005 he was scientific employee at the Bundesagentur für Arbeit. Florian Janik is married to Sylvia Janik and has two children, Lotta Janik (born 2009) and Max Janik (born 2011).


Political career

In 1998, Janik joined the Social Democratic Party of Germany, SPD and became member of Erlangen's town council in 2002. In 2008, he took over the leadership of his coalition party. In the mayor election on 16 March 2014 he got 37.2% of all votes. In the final ballot on 20 March 2014 he won against the previous mayor Siegfried Balleis (Christian Social Union in Bavaria, CSU). His term began on 1 May 2014. In the local elections on March 15, 2020, he competed against seven competitors and won 39.2% of the votes in the first round. In the runoff election on March 29, 2020, he won 54.5% of the vote against Jörg Volleth (CSU). Janik will thus remains Lord Mayor of Erlangen until April 30, 2026.
